Members of the community in Scourie turned out for a festive tractor run event on Christmas Eve, raising a total of £355 for Highland Hospice.
The run ended at Scourie pavilion where refreshments were enjoyed with some carol singing.
Organiser Aileen MacDonald said: "Many thanks to all who came along and supported the event. Great big thanks and well done to everyone who put so much effort into decorating the tractors. Elves – you all looked superb – well done!
"But the biggest thanks have to go to Santa and Mrs Claus who took time out of their very busy schedule to stop in and see the boys and girls in Scourie. Thank you so much!"
